Frequently Asked Questions

Can Terraform detect drift in AWS ElastiCache automatically?

Terraform can detect drift by comparing state with real-world resources using 'terraform refresh' or 'plan', but continuous automatic drift detection requires integration with external tools or Terraform Cloud's paid features.

Does Redis Enterprise Operator support hybrid cloud Redis setups?

Yes, Redis Enterprise Kubernetes Operator supports External-Master configuration, enabling hybrid setups where a Redis cluster in Kubernetes replicates from an external master, such as AWS ElastiCache.
